Selecting the Right Product for the Job



Not all floor protection solutions are created equal. Choosing the right one depends on your flooring and the intensity of the work.




  • Carpet protection adheres lightly to carpet fibers without altering texture, guarding against paint.

  • For hard floors, rigid sheets like Correx or Antinox offer dependable protective coverage, and are easy to install.

  • In wet areas, grip-enhanced coverings provide added safety for both workers and guests.



These products are available in a range of formats, making them perfect for everything from DIY jobs to large-scale commercial builds.
